Carl Christian Redlich
Carl Christian Redlich (born October 7, 1832 in Hamburg , † July 27, 1900 in Eilbeck ) was a German philologist , Germanist and educator .
Life
He was a teacher at the learned school of the Johanneum and director of the secondary school in front of the Holstentore in Hamburg. He wrote works on Lessing and Claudius and studies on the muse almanacs. He was an employee of the ADB .
Fonts (selection)
- The astronomer Meton and his cycle. A contribution to the Greek chronology . Hamburg 1854.
- Attempt of a cipher lexicon on the Göttingen, Vossian, Schiller and Schlegel-Tieck musenalmanacs . Hamburg 1875.
- As editor: Matthias Claudius: Unprinted youth letters of the Wandsbecker messenger . Hamburg 1881.
- as editor: Johann Gottfried Herder: Poetic works . Berlin 1885.
